Mesothelioma Compensation Claims

Mesothelioma compensation claims can assist patients and their families pay for the cost of treatment. They can also help with expenses for caregiving as well as other expenses caused by asbestos exposure.

Compensation could be offered through a trust fund or mesothelioma lawsuit. A top asbestos lawyer will examine your case and suggest the best claim for you.

Medical expenses

Mesothelioma treatment can be expensive. Many of the patients are financially strapped due to the high medical costs and lost wages. Asbestos victims could be entitled to compensation through asbestos trust funds or lawsuits. These funds can be used to cover the costs and ensure that victims and their families are financially secure for many years to be.

Mesothelioma patients must pay for various types of medical expenses, which include hospitalizations, surgery, and chemotherapy. These expenses can be costly and patients must stay on in mind the process of building their mesothelioma treatment case.

For instance the typical chemotherapy regimen consisting of pemetrexed (Alimta) and cisplatin will cost between $40,000 and $50,000 per infusion over several weeks. A patient might also need to undergo lung-related surgery for example, the pneumonectomy for the lungs. The average cost of surgery is between $20,000 and $30,000.

Many mesothelioma sufferers also hire caregivers to assist with routine tasks and errands. The cost of caregivers, transport and accommodation can quickly add up. Patients frequently seek complementary and alternative treatments, such as yoga or acupuncture, to improve their health and lessen the side effects of mesothelioma. In a study conducted in the year 2016, mesothelioma patients reported spending anywhere from $400 to $650 per year on these treatments. Mesothelioma lawyers can help track and organize expenses to build a case.

VA benefits

Veterans who suffer from mesothelioma or other asbestos-related illnesses may qualify for a range of VA benefits. They can also receive compensation through trust funds, settlements, or payouts from lawsuits. These awards of compensation can help pay for treatment and related expenses.

Mesothelioma patients have to concentrate on their health, however that isn't easy when they don't have easy access to financial assistance. Compensation can help to offset expenses, including living and travel expenses. Patients with mesothelioma are often forced to leave their lives in limbo during treatment. The ability to access money lets them focus their focus on their health and keep their families moving.

Certain mesothelioma patients receive a special monthly benefits from the VA known as "Aid and Attendance" (A&A). This tax-free benefit aids veterans who manage mesothelioma or other asbestos-related diseases pay for their daily care costs including in-home nursing services. A&A can also assist in covering costs for home maintenance and utilities.

Some mesothelioma attorneys work with a VA-accredited claim agent to ensure that each benefit application is filed without errors and in accordance with VA guidelines. This increases the likelihood of a veteran obtaining benefits. Veterans who receive mesothelioma benefits can also make use of their benefits to get free or low-cost mesothelioma treatments from an VA mesothelioma expert. This is in addition to any disability compensation or pension payments they may receive.

Social Disability from Social Security

Due to the condition, mesothelioma patients often need disability benefits. In order to qualify for Social Security disability, a person must be able to provide documentation that shows they are unable to engage in substantial gainful activity because of their medical condition. Mesothelioma attorneys can help you obtain the documentation needed to make a successful claim for disability.

Mesothelioma patients who apply for Social Security disability must provide complete medical documents. These records must contain the nature and location of the disease. The application must contain the opinion of a doctor as well as pathology reports and operative notes. The presence of all the required documents in place can aid in speeding the approval process.

The SSA has a program called Compassionate Allowances which assists identify severe conditions so that the agency can review them faster. This can accelerate the process of getting approved for mesothelioma benefits.
